The Favourites is a new novel loosely based on Wuthering Heights:
Layne Fargo
Penguin Books - Chatto & Windus
Published: 16/01/2025 (Hardback) (Paperback in September)
ISBN: 9781784745486

Everyone thinks Heath Rocha was my first love. He wasn’t. My first love was figure skating.

She might not have a famous name, funding, or her family’s support, but Katarina Shaw has always known that she was destined to become an Olympic skater. When she meets Heath Rocha, a lonely kid stuck in the foster care system, their instant connection makes them a formidable duo on the ice. Clinging to skating – and each other – to escape their turbulent lives, Kat and Heath go from childhood sweethearts to champion ice dancers, captivating the world with their scorching chemistry, rebellious style, and rollercoaster relationship.

Until a shocking incident at the Olympic Games brings their partnership to a sudden end.

As the ten-year anniversary of their final skate approaches, an unauthorised documentary reignites the public obsession with Shaw and Rocha, claiming to uncover the ‘real story’ through interviews with their closest friends and fiercest rivals. Kat wants nothing to do with the documentary. But she can't stand the thought of someone else defining her legacy either. So, after a decade of silence, she's telling her story: from the childhood tragedies that created her all-consuming bond with Heath to the clash of desires that tore them apart. Sensational rumours have haunted their every step for years, but the truth may be even more shocking than the headlines.

Alternating Kat’s own account of her dramatic rise and devastating fall with scandalous snippets from the tell-all film, and capturing the can’t-look-away intensity of Emily Bronte’s classic novel, The Favourites is an exhilarating dance between passion, ambition, and what it truly means to win.
The author on National Book Tokens lists her favourite (no pun intended) Wuthering Heights adaptations:
Wuthering Heights is one of the most controversial classic novels, but also one of the most enduring. Whether you love or hate tempestuous central couple Catherine and Heathcliff, you can't help having strong feelings about them – and I, for one, adore them, so much so that I wrote a modern adaptation of their timeless story: The Favourites, which sets the passion and intensity of Wuthering Heights in the cutthroat world of Olympic figure skating. As I was researching, I checked out plenty of other adaptations of Emily Brontë’s novel for inspiration. Here are my personal favourites.
